Tuesday, March 26, 2002 Each year, approximately 24 Jr. and Sr. High School Jazz Bands come to work with five guest artists. It culminates with an evening concert featuring three outstanding bands selected during the day, the Red Rock Central High School Jazz Band, and a guest university band, with the five guest artists as soloists. Artists in 2002 will be Kirk Garrison, Kim Park, Frank Mantooth, John Fedchock and Jim McKinney. Steve Wright and the Gustavus Adolphus Jazz Band will be our guest unversity band this year. Sunday, July 14 , 2002 Tuba Mania was conceived and founded in 1995 by Martin Meidl and Heritagefest, Inc. Heritagefest is an enourmous, two weekend festival of German heritage. It has been held every July for many years at the Brown County Fair Grounds in New Ulm, MN. Special Featured Tuba Soloist this year will be Tom Wells, tuba virtuoso. . Special musical arrangements have been written for this event, including polkas, waltzes, and German marches. They are written in four part harmony for baritone/euphonium and tuba. We will also have a small tuba ensemble playing a couple of neat numbers with trap set and vocal. Players of any age from anywhere are invited to play in the ensemble. The ensemble, with a past membership of nearly 100, is conducted by Martin Meidl from The Music Mart. Invitations are mailed out from the Heritagefest Office in New Ulm, MN. around early to mid-May.
